|
|
|
Избитый вопрос про кодировку...
|
|||
|---|---|---|---|
|
#18+
Подскажите пожалуйста как в созданной БД добавить параметр "DEFAULT CHARACTER SET WIN1251". Проблема в том, что подключаюсь я к БД используя параметр Database.Params.Values ['lc_ctype'] := 'WIN1251'; Все данные вносятся правильно, т.е. русские буквы Interbase проглатывает. Но когда создал процедуру в которой осуществляеся выборка и добавление новой записи с параметрами ввиде русских слов, то выдается сообщение об ошибке. Arithmetic overflow or division by zero has occurred. arithmetic exception, numeric overflow, or string truncation. Cannot transliterate character between character sets. Что делать??? Пожалуйста помогите, горит диплом.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.11.2003, 14:50 |
|
||
|
Избитый вопрос про кодировку...
|
|||
|---|---|---|---|
|
#18+
Проверь кодировки созданных полей и кодировку по умолчанию в базе (поле RDB$CHARACTER_SET_NAME таблицы RDB$DATABASE)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.11.2003, 15:06 |
|
||
|
Избитый вопрос про кодировку...
|
|||
|---|---|---|---|
|
#18+
Кодировка созданных полей и в RDB$CHARACTER_SET_NAME стоит WIN1251. Что делать, ПОМОГИТЕ?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.11.2003, 15:11 |
|
||
|
Избитый вопрос про кодировку...
|
|||
|---|---|---|---|
|
#18+
Ну так явно в прописуй кодировку в переменных процедуры и следи чтоб переполнения строк небыло. В общем пересоздай процедуру. Надеюсь об этом ты знаешь.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.11.2003, 15:25 |
|
||
|
Избитый вопрос про кодировку...
|
|||
|---|---|---|---|
|
#18+
Так я и создавал с помощью IBExpert, только почему то если явно задать WIN1251, он не хочет сохранять этот параметр.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.11.2003, 15:41 |
|
||
|
Избитый вопрос про кодировку...
|
|||
|---|---|---|---|
|
#18+
У меня компилиться всё успешно: Код: plaintext 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.11.2003, 16:16 |
|
||
|
|

start [/forum/topic.php?fid=40&msg=32327676&tid=1579638]: |
0ms |
get settings: |
9ms |
get forum list: |
16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
49ms |
get topic data: |
9ms |
get forum data: |
2ms |
get page messages: |
37ms |
get tp. blocked users: |
2ms |
| others: | 238ms |
| total: | 368ms |

| 0 / 0 |
